Отправляет email-рассылки с помощью сервиса Sendsay
  Все выпуски  

Задачи и решения по программированию в среде TurboPascal - Движение к звездам


Информационный Канал Subscribe.Ru

Задачи и решения по программированию в среде Turbo Pascal

Здравствуйте, уважаемые подписчики. Перед Вами 14 номер рассылки. Подписалось 1850+

Ответ к задаче "Картинная галерея"

( Евгений Зайцев, Сергей Юшанов )

var l,k,j,i,n:integer;

pl:real;

f:text;

x,y:array[1..100]of integer;

s:array[1..100]of real;

Begin

assign(f,'gallery.in');reset(f);

readln(f,n);

for i:=1 to n do readln(f,x[i],y[i]);

close(f);

for i:=1 to n do begin

for j:=1 to n do begin

l:=j-1;if l=0 then l:=n;

pl:=0.5*abs(x[i]*y[j]+x[j]*y[l]+x[l]*y[i]-x[l]*y[j]-x[j]*y[i]-x[i]*y[l]);

s[i]:=s[i]+pl;

end;

end;l:=0;

assign(f,'gallery.out');rewrite(f);

for i:=1 to n do if s[1]<>s[i] then inc(l);

if l=0 then write(f,'NO') else write(f,'YES');

close(f);

end.


 

"Движение к звездам "

Движение к звездам.  Иллюминатор космического корабля обращен в сторону его стремительного движения к звездам. Создайте программу, которая рисует «звездное небо» видимое из иллюминатора: звезды двигаются по направлению от центра экрана к его краям.

Примечание: можно использовать графику

 

Вопросы читателей

1.Напечатать список группы и средний балл каждого студента.

2.Создать программу для составления списка пациентов старше N лет с
диагнозом Y, старше M лет с диагнозом Z.

3.Написать программу, которая напечатает список студентов, желающих
прослушать дисциплину X; если число желающих превысит 8 человек, то
отобрать студентов, имеющих более высокий балл успеваемости.

4.Написать программу, выдающую следующую информацию о наличии и
стоимости обуви артикула X, - ассортиментный список мужской обуви с
указанием наименования и наличия числа пар каждой модели.

Ответить: mailto:romeo606@rambler.ru

-----------------------------------------------------

Общее условие задач: Число m получается из числа n следующим образом : сначала идут кратные трем
цифры числа m затем кратные двум, затем все остальные.
1. n и m числа целого типа но программа должна работать корректно для числа n содержащего не
менее 9 цифр.
2. n представляет собой массив const из цифр размерность которых неограниченна. В этом массиве
сделать перестановку получив m не пользуясь вспомогательным массивом.
3. n и m имеют тип string длинна n может составлять до 255 симвалов.
Ответить: mailto:max-stept@yandex.ru

 

 

 -----------------------------------------------------

]Как через TurboPascal запустить какой-нибудь файл
Спасибо!!!

Ответить: mailto:andrej2003@inbox.ru

-----------------------------------------------------

Помогите, пожалуйста, с программой симплекс-метода на Турбо Паскале.

Ответить: mailto:seryoga_77@mail.ru

-----------------------------------------------------

Вот и все! Удачи!

Если есть вопросы по программированию в Turbo Pascal или решенные и нерешенные задачи, то присылайте на mailto:vmftem@mail.ru с темой Pascal

 

 



http://subscribe.ru/
E-mail: ask@subscribe.ru
Отписаться
Убрать рекламу

В избранное